Buenas tardes a todos.
Estoy usando desde hace mucho la clase TCdoMail. Y ahora me encuentro con la necesidad de usar la propiedad lReceipt pero parece que no esta implementada. Alguna sugerencia.
Gracias.
Pepe.
In order for this site to work correctly we need to store a small file (called a cookie) on your computer. Most every site in the world does this, however since the 25th of May 2011, by law we have to get your permission first. Please abandon the forum if you disagree.
Para que este foro funcione correctamente es necesario guardar un pequeño fichero (llamado cookie) en su ordenador. La mayoría de los sitios de Internet lo hacen, no obstante desde el 25 de Marzo de 2011 y por ley, necesitamos de su permiso con antelación. Abandone este foro si no está conforme.
Para que este foro funcione correctamente es necesario guardar un pequeño fichero (llamado cookie) en su ordenador. La mayoría de los sitios de Internet lo hacen, no obstante desde el 25 de Marzo de 2011 y por ley, necesitamos de su permiso con antelación. Abandone este foro si no está conforme.
TCdoMail propiedad lReceipt
-
- Mensajes: 131
- Registrado: Mié Jun 16, 2010 2:33 pm
-
- Mensajes: 131
- Registrado: Mié Jun 16, 2010 2:33 pm
Re: TCdoMail propiedad lReceipt
Ignacio se podría implementar en la clase TCdoMail esto:
WITH OBJECT ::oObj
//*- Notificación de lectura
If ::lReceipt
:Fields("urn:schemas:mailheader:disposition-notification-to"):Value := ::cFrom
:Fields("urn:schemas:mailheader:return-receipt-to"):Value := ::cFrom
:Fields:Update()
EndIf
END
Muchas gracias
WITH OBJECT ::oObj
//*- Notificación de lectura
If ::lReceipt
:Fields("urn:schemas:mailheader:disposition-notification-to"):Value := ::cFrom
:Fields("urn:schemas:mailheader:return-receipt-to"):Value := ::cFrom
:Fields:Update()
EndIf
END
Muchas gracias
- ignacio
- Site Admin
- Mensajes: 9283
- Registrado: Lun Abr 06, 2015 8:00 pm
- Ubicación: Madrid, Spain
- Contactar:
Re: TCdoMail propiedad lReceipt
Buenos días,
Le sugiero que sobrecargue la clase T y haga usted mismo los cambios.
Un saludo
Le sugiero que sobrecargue la clase T y haga usted mismo los cambios.
Un saludo
Código: Seleccionar todo
CLASS TCDOMail FROM XCDOMail
PROPERTY lReceipt INIT .F.
METHOD Send()
ENDCLASS
METHOD Send() CLASS XCDOMail
WITH OBJECT ::oObj
If ::lReceipt
:Fields("urn:schemas:mailheader:disposition-notification-to"):Value := ::cFrom
:Fields("urn:schemas:mailheader:return-receipt-to"):Value := ::cFrom
:Fields:Update()
EndIf
END WITH
RETURN ::Super:Send()
-
- Mensajes: 131
- Registrado: Mié Jun 16, 2010 2:33 pm
Re: TCdoMail propiedad lReceipt
Genial Ignacio muchas gracias por su ayuda.
Pepe.
Pepe.